TYRANNIA - A ticket sells for nearly 600 NP. That one ticket is admission to the
most glorious event at the Tyrannian Concert Hall, the best concert hall in all
of Neopia. Bands such as the country 2 Gallon Hats and rock & roll Sticks 'N Stones
come to play at the Hall. Many concert goers, however, are reluctant to stretch
their meager National Neopian Bank accounts to go to such a pricey occasion. I
am also reluctant to let Skalpo the Techo (owner) or the bands cheat anyone out
of their NP.

The following reviews each and every band that has ever come to the Tyrannian
Concert Hall, and ones that return as well. You will never ever think the same
of these bands again.
Band name: 2 Gallon Hatz
Fun Fact: Peggie Sue Percival was a model for the Clothes Shop
Best Song(s): "Frost Cannon Battledome Blues"
Vocals: Thick and sweet
Music: Knee-bouncing country rhythms with banjo and drums
Performance: Supple, yet meager stage settings
Sound Quality: Efficient
Overall: 3/5 - Something to square dance to
Band name: Blue Kacheek Group
Fun Fact: Blue Kacheek #2 sang back-up for pop group M*YNCI.
Best Song(s): "Raining Lupes" and "Breaking Free"
Vocals: None
Music: Creative and original
Performance: Delightfully entertaining
Sound Quality: You can feel the sound waves
Overall: 5/5 - A MUST SEE!
Band name: Chomby and the Fungus Balls
Fun Fact: Chomby's marking on his body is actually a washable tattoo.
Best Song(s): "Whoo!"
Vocals: Repetitively annoying
Music: Fun, oldies pop flashback
Performance: Energetic and colorful (Fungus Balls)
Sound Quality: Low-key; Chomby sounds like he's whispering if you sit in the
back seats
Overall: 2/5 - If it wasn't for the Fungus Balls and instrumentals Chomby
would be nothing
Band name: Jazzmosis
Fun Fact: Jazzmosis' Elephante uses his own trunk to create sounds
Best Song(s): ANYTHING! (Literally and not a song)
Vocals: Soulful and deep
Music: The air instrument players rule the stage
Performance: Scenery is a timeless black-and-white; half-way through the show
you might fall asleep to the jazzy tunes
Sound Quality: Just right
Overall: 4/5 - A show to enjoy by yourself or with your sweetheart
Band name: Moehawkz
Fun Fact: Red Star the Moehog stowed away into a record producer's suitcase
to show him their demo tape
Best Song(s): "The Truth," "Zig and zag," and "Boom"
Vocals: Occasional screaming, yelling into the mic; unbelievably amazing
Music: Electric guitar, keyboard, and drums complete them
Performance: Head-bopping and mosh worthy
Sound Quality: I CAN'T HEAR YOU!
Overall: 5/5 - Lighting DOES strike!
Band name: M*YNCI
Fun Fact: Their first gig was at a birthday party for Queen Fyora
Best Song(s): None
Vocals: They all sound the same
Music: Giddy pop music
Performance: Cheesy
Sound Quality: OK
Overall: 0/5 - If you want to be mindlessly happy, go to their show, zombie
Band name: Sticks 'N Stones
Fun Fact: They are the first rock group in all of Neopia
Best Song(s): None
Vocals: Hearty
Music: Classic and unforgettable rock
Performance: Blurry and fast pace; fun to watch
Sound Quality: Super
Overall: 4/5 - Take your dad and mum to this; youngsters beware
Band name: Wock 'Til You Drop
Fun Fact: Ice the Wocky froze himself to live up to his name
Best Song(s):
Vocals: Miserable
Music: Haunting
Performance: Depressing and everyone looks as if they needed a good cry
Sound Quality: Great
Overall: 1/5 - I dropped (The one point is for Ice the Wocky. He looks funny
in the ice block...)
Band name: Yes Boy Ice Cream
Fun Fact: Ricky the Blue Shoyru and Jason the Red Shoyru are fraternal twins
Best Song(s): "Flying in the Sky" and "Mortog Kisser" (just about anything)
Vocals: Pleasant and youthful
Music: Techo and dance beats make you boogie at the first sound!
Performance: Great special effects and lighting; definite eye candy
Sound Quality: Okay
Overall: 5/5 - I'm going again!
